Responsibilities Develop detailed production area models using tools such as process flows, value stream maps, Pareto charts, spaghetti diagrams, and CAD drawings. Analyze operational data and performance metrics to identify bottlenecks, inefficiencies, and opportunities for improvement.

Contribute to long‑term strategic roadmaps focused on capacity planning, automation, digital transformation, infrastructure upgrades, and new technology integration. Collaborate with cross‑functional teams including program management, operations, facilities, and engineering to optimize factory layouts and support evolving program requirements. Lead and support FMEA reviews, scrap material analyses, feasibility studies, and ROI‑based cost‑benefit evaluations to drive continuous improvement.

Support initiatives aimed at maximizing throughput, improving efficiency, and ensuring on‑time delivery for customers within a high‑mix, mid‑volume production environment.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Industrial / Manufacturing Engineering, or a related engineering/science discipline. Minimum 3 years of experience in a manufacturing environment (defense industry experience preferred).

Working toward or eligible for a P.Eng license. Experience in high‑mix, mid‑volume production environments. Familiarity with Lean Manufacturing and/or Six Sigma principles.

Experience with capacity analysis, manufacturing technologies, production systems, and performance metrics (preferred). Knowledge of simulation tools (preferred). Proficiency with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ma methodologies, simulation tools, and CAD software.
